在前端页面嵌套iframe时,如果在iframe内发送请求跨域,需要采取以下措施:

  1. 在父页面中设置CORS(跨域资源共享)策略,允许指定的跨域请求访问资源。

  2. 使用JSONP(JSON with Padding)方式进行数据传输,JSONP是一种跨域传输数据的方法,通过script标签的src属性来请求数据,服务器返回的数据需要包装在函数调用中。

  3. 使用代理服务器,将跨域请求转发到代理服务器,再由代理服务器向目标服务器发送请求,将数据返回给页面。

  4. 在目标服务器上设置允许跨域访问的响应头,例如Access-Control-Allow-Origin。

以上几种方法都可以解决在iframe内发送跨域请求的问题,具体选择哪种方法取决于具体情况和需求。

前端页面 嵌套 iframe 在iframe内发送请求跨域怎么处理

原文地址: https://www.cveoy.top/t/topic/dvK0 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录